Virat Kohli Fastest Cricketer to Take 6000 Runs in ODI

Indian batsman Virat Kohli has added another feather to his hat by becoming the fastest cricketer to reach the 6000 run mark in One Day International matches. Kohli achieved this landmark in the 3rd ​ODI in the series against Sri Lanka on Sunday, November 9, 2014 at the Rajiv Gandhi International Stadium in Uppal, Hyderabad.

Virat Kohli breaks Vivian Richards’ Record of Fastest 6000 Runs

The record for the Fastest 6000 runs ever made by any batsman in the world was previously held by West Indies’ batting legend Vivian Richards, who achieved the feat in 141 innings. Richards has been the holder of this honor for the past 25 years, since 1989. Virat Kohli has taken only 136 innings to get to the 6000 run mark.

The name of another Indian player, Saurav Ganguly comes in right under the name of Vivian Richards in the list of top batsmen to get to 6000 runs in One Day International Cricket matches.

Top 10 Quickest Batsmen to Reach 6000 ODI Runs

1. Virat Kohli of India in 136 innings
2. Vivian Richards of West Indies in 141 innings
3. Sourav Ganguly of India in 147 innings
4. AB de Villiers of South Africa in 147 innings
4. Matthew Hayden of Australia in 154 innings
6. Brian Lara of West Indies in 155 innings
7. Dean Jones of Australia in 157 innings
8. Gary Kirsten of South Africa in 160 innings
8. Graeme Smith of South Africa in 160 innings
10. Desmond Haynes of west Indies in 162 innings
10. Saeed Anwar of Pakistan in 162 innings
